About Anna B. Berry

Anna B. Berry is a scholar working on Pulmonary and Respiratory Medicine, Cancer Research, Surgery, Oncology and Genetics, having authored 37 papers that have together received 464 indexed citations. Recurring topics across this work include Cancer Genomics and Diagnostics (9 papers), BRCA gene mutations in cancer (6 papers), Bladder and Urothelial Cancer Treatments (6 papers), Lung Cancer Treatments and Mutations (5 papers), Lung Cancer Diagnosis and Treatment (3 papers), Economic and Financial Impacts of Cancer (3 papers), Health and Medical Research Impacts (2 papers) and Breast Cancer Treatment Studies (2 papers). The work is most often cited by research in Music (20 citations), Cancer Research (70 citations), Genetics (94 citations), Oncology (72 citations) and Surgery (114 citations). Anna B. Berry has collaborated with scholars based in United States, United Kingdom and India. Frequent co-authors include Badrinath R. Konety, Peter R. Carroll, Kirsten L. Greene, John D. Pfeifer, Burton S. Rosner, Philip A. Fine, Jared M. Whitson, Sophia Yohe, Britt‐Marie Ljung and P. Pearl O’Rourke. Their work appears in journals such as Journal of Clinical Oncology, Archives of Pathology & Laboratory Medicine, JCO Clinical Cancer Informatics, Cancer Research and Journal of Molecular Diagnostics.
